ja⋅la⋅pe⋅ño

[hah-luh-peyn-yoh; Sp. hah-lah-pe-nyaw]
–noun, plural -pe⋅ños [-peyn-yohz; Sp. -pe-nyaws] .
a hot green or orange-red pepper, the fruit of a variety of Capsicum annuum, used esp. in Mexican cooking.
Also, ja⋅la⋅pe⋅no.
Also called jalapeño pepper.


Origin:
1935–40; < MexSp (chile) jalapeño (chile of) Jalapa
